🎓 Overview of Mondragon Unibertsitatea

Mondragon Unibertsitatea, often abbreviated as MU, is a private cooperative university located primarily in Eskoriatza, a charming town in Euskadi, Spain's Basque Country. Founded in 1997 as part of the renowned Mondragon Corporation, it embodies the principles of worker cooperatives, emphasizing democratic governance, social responsibility, and high employability. Unlike traditional universities, jobs at Mondragon Unibertsitatea integrate academic pursuits with practical industry collaboration, making it a unique destination for professionals in higher education.

The university serves around 4,000 students across three campuses: Eskoriatza (Faculty of Humanities and Education), Arrasate (Engineering), and Aretxabaleta (Gastronomy and Business). Its commitment to Basque culture means many roles require proficiency in Euskera (Basque language), alongside Spanish and English. Jobs here range from teaching faculty to research specialists, administrative leaders, and support staff, all contributing to an ecosystem where education meets real-world application.

📜 History and Unique Cooperative Model

Mondragon Unibertsitatea emerged from the Mondragon cooperative experience, which began in 1956 with a small technical school. By the 1990s, it evolved into a full-fledged university focused on vocational training. This history shapes jobs at the institution, prioritizing roles that foster innovation and entrepreneurship. Employees often participate in cooperative decision-making, owning shares in the university's governance structure—a rarity in higher education.

The cooperative model influences hiring: candidates are evaluated not just on credentials but on alignment with values like solidarity and sustainability. This has led to impressive outcomes, with graduates boasting a 90-95% employability rate within six months, directly impacting faculty and researcher roles that emphasize industry partnerships.

Definitions

Key terms for jobs at Mondragon Unibertsitatea include:

  • Cooperative University: A higher education institution owned and managed by its members (faculty, staff, students), emphasizing democratic participation over hierarchical structures.
  • Euskera: The Basque language, co-official in Euskadi, required for local integration and teaching.
  • Mondragon Corporation: A federation of worker cooperatives in the Basque Country, partner to the university for research and placements.
  • Employability Rate: Percentage of graduates employed shortly after completion, a key metric at MU exceeding 90%.
